ISO NEW ENGLAND Inc., which operates the region's electric grid, said Monday that it does not anticipate severe electricity shortages this winter.
PROVIDENCE – Mild temperatures and proactive planning should ensure there’s enough power to meet regional electricity needs this winter, according to ISO New England Inc. ISO offered up an outlook on winter energy supply, predicting that controlled outages are unlikely, according to its forecast published Monday.
